One evening in March 1860 a party of gentlemen were assembled at Dysart House when it was suggested that perhaps Fife should have its own cavalry regiment. The idea was favourably received and the task of forming the regiment fell to Colonel Anstruther Thomson., who in 1892 wrote a comprehensive history of the regiment from its inception.
